Abstract

Purpose The aim of this paper is to explore the specific relationship between managerial power and enterprise innovation performance. Combined with managerial power theory and stewardship theory, financing constraints and strategic orientation, including, strategic market orientation and strategic technology orientation are included in the analysis framework to test how managerial power influences enterprise innovation performance in detail from the perspective of enterprise internal influence mechanisms. Design/methodology/approach Based on the A-share listed companies in Shanghai and Shenzhen covering the period from 2001 to 2017, this paper uses the ordinary least square method (OLS) to explore how managerial power affects enterprise innovation performance. Findings The results show that managerial power has a positive impact on enterprise innovation performance. Furthermore, the authors find that financing constraints, strategic market orientation and strategic technology orientation all have partial mediating effects in the relationship between managerial power and enterprise innovation performance. Originality/value This paper verifies the application of managerial power theory and stewardship theory in the relationship between managerial power and enterprise innovation performance in Chinese A-share listed companies, contributing to the literature on enterprise innovation. Moreover, by introducing the mediating mechanisms of financing constraints, strategic market orientation and strategic technology orientation, this paper builds an effective path for in-depth study to analyze how managerial power influences enterprise innovation performance and finds ways to improve enterprise innovation performance from the inside view of the enterprise.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call